Output e5498c648c70d3929303be39edd10300dca9776f9fd689a1aff0ea8acdd5f3d2:0

value
859158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d3f75a2ae2b010251c54b7403edbfbcd88ef79f OP_EQUAL
address
3EZsDqT3Pe9CBQUNz1nXpYvvAFsQYokGY2
transaction
e5498c648c70d3929303be39edd10300dca9776f9fd689a1aff0ea8acdd5f3d2
spent
true